WebAn event is a notification sent by an object to signal the occurrence of an action. Events in .NET follow the observer design pattern. The class who raises events is called Publisher, and the class who receives the notification is called Subscriber. There can be multiple subscribers of a single event. bob swearingen obituary

There is a subtle difference between event listeners and event … WebLonger answer: An event has to have a delegate type, but EventHandler is just one delegate type. It's legal to make an event using an Action of some type. WebSep 8, 2024 · The event handlers do not return a value, so you need to communicate that in another way. The standard event pattern uses the EventArgs object to include fields that event subscribers can use to communicate cancel. WebApr 11, 2024 · Events are typically used to signal user actions such as button clicks or menu selections in graphical user interfaces. When an event has multiple subscribers, the event handlers are invoked synchronously when an event is raised. To invoke events asynchronously, see Calling Synchronous Methods Asynchronously.
